The leisure, travel, and recreation industry is at a critical point. Inflation and limited mobility will force changes in both the quantity and use of leisure time in the next decade, and use patterns for public parks and recreational sites will change drastically. This article discusses trends for the 1980s and suggests implications for the forecast changes.
